What is the B1 Exam Certificate?
The B1 Exam Certificate functions as a testament to an individual's ability to use English in a variety of real-life circumstances. It becomes part of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), which categorizes language proficiency into six levels: A1, A2, B1, B2, C1, and C2. The B1 level suggests that a person can:
Understand the main points of clear basic input on familiar matters.Handle many situations that arise while taking a trip in a location where English is spoken.Produce basic linked text on subjects that recognize or of individual interest.Describe experiences, events, dreams, and aspirations, along with briefly explain reasons and opinions.Value of the B1 Exam Certificate

Comprehending the structure of the B1 Zertifikat Deutsch Exam is vital for preparation. The exam generally consists of four sections: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Below is a breakdown of each part:
SectionDescriptionTimingListeningCandidates listen to numerous recordings and answer associated concerns.20 minutesReadingThe reading section consists of different texts followed by understanding concerns.60 minutesComposingProspects compose short texts, such as e-mails or essays, on offered subjects.60 minutesSpeakingA face-to-face interview where candidates discuss topics, response concerns, and get involved in dialogue.10-15 minutesTest Topics for Each SectionAreaSample TopicsListeningWeather report, discussions in public locations.Checking outArticles, ads, and short stories.WritingExplain a buddy, write a postcard, or narrate a holiday experience.SpeakingTalk about hobbies, discuss future plans, or explain a preferred book.Preparing for the B1 Exam
